Usage Note
Saignement is the standard medical and everyday term for bleeding. Saignement de nez (nosebleed) is a common compound. The related verb is saigner (to bleed), and the adjective saignant(e) describes undercooked red meat — 'rare' in culinary contexts. Do not confuse saignement with hémorragie (f), which implies more severe blood loss.
